2025-02-09nonguix: chromium-binary-build: Extend wrapper-plan syntax.•••This commit is similar to a0079cf1bd8ef707ab9e15a0e249cbd34f157ae4 which allowed patchelf-plan to take entries with an optional path. Here, wrapper-plan is extended to allow for additional syntax (not just a list of strings) similar to patchelf-plan. Now, entries can be a list, with the first the string for the file to be patched and the second a list which is added to the patchelf-plan. This allows, for example, to patch RPATH to effectively have $ORIGIN for binaries that need it, with an entry like `("bin/binary" (("out" "/lib/Binary")))` common for some chromium-based packages. See followup commits for these changes to reduce LD_LIBRARY_PATH wrapping in some packages. * nonguix/build-system/chromium-binary.scm (build-patchelf-plan): Handle entries in wrapper-plan which are a list so that the cdr is added to patchelf-plan for the car. (chromium-binary-build): Update doc string for this change and some basics which were not documented. John Kehayias

2024-01-06nonguix: multiarch-container: Set LD_LIBRARY_PATH inside container.•••Fixes #303. Previously LD_LIBRARY_PATH was being set before the container was launched, which could cause issues on some foreign distros where this alters what is loaded from an FHS structure. This was only meant to be set inside the container, though this didn't cause any issues on a Guix System. * nonguix/multiarch-container.scm (make-container-wrapper): Move setting LD_LIBRARY_PATH from here ... (make-internal-script): ... to here. John Kehayias
2024-01-04nongnu: multiarch-container: Fix missing module on foreign distros.•••Fixes #277. See discussion in above issue for details and some education on what went wrong here. In short, we didn't capture the needed (guix build utils) module in the container script. On a Guix System this didn't cause any problems as guix modules are found through set Guile environment variables. But on a foreign distro these weren't set without hacky workarounds. This prevented Steam from launching with a "no code for module" error. * nonguix/multiarch-container.scm (make-container-wrapper)[make-container-wrapper]: Use 'with-imported-modules' for (guix build utils). John Kehayias

2024-01-03nongnu: steam-nvidia: Fix launching .desktop files.•••Steam installs .desktop files that refer to an executable called `steam'. Installing steam-nvidia as the `steam-nvidia' executable breaks this, which means Steam cannot be launched from its desktop icon. This also applies to .desktop files for individual games generated by Steam, when they are copied from `<ngc-sandbox-home>/.local/share/applications/'. Fix this by always installing Steam's wrapper executable as `steam'. We add a new field using "binary" to keep things shorter. This has the downside that the `steam' and `steam-nvidia' packages cannot be installed in the same profile, but likely people wouldn't want to do this anyway. Fixes #294. * nongnu/packages/steam-client.scm (steam-nvidia-container)[binary-name]: Specify for compatibility with .desktop files. * nonguix/multiarch-container.scm (<nonguix-container>)[binary-name, ngc-binary-name]: New field and accessor. (nonguix-container->package): Use it to set correct executable name. (make-internal-script): Use it in message. Co-authored-by: John Kehayias <john.kehayias@protonmail.com> Signed-off-by: John Kehayias <john.kehayias@protonmail.com> Timo Wilken
